The first impression

Holiday Bear Edition Polo Red by Ralph Lauren is a Woody Spicy fragrance for men. Holiday Bear Edition Polo Red was launched in 2019. Top note is Pink Grapefruit; middle note is Saffron; base note is Brazilian Redwood.
